April 2025: The American Landscape A Group Exhibition Of Visual Art
Visit Richard Boyd Art Gallery in April to experience an exquisite annual exhibition of landscape paintings. Landscape art has been a significant genre of art for centuries and remains one of the most collected. Whether created en plein air to capture the natural light and color in the area, created in a studio setting using a sketch or photograph as a reference, or painted from memory, each painting embodies the artist’s vision of that place in time.
The exhibit is comprised of paintings expressing feelings associated with wilderness areas, micro-studies of nature, and realistic landscape paintings depicting the artist’s interpretation of a specific scene or a detailed rendering of the landscape before them.
The exhibition showcases a stunning selection of paintings by highly regarded, award-winning, and established artists Jane Herbert a distinguished fine and commercial artist known for her calming, beautifully detailed acrylic paintings; Deena S. Ball a nationally renowned art educator and instructor known for her plein air watercolor paintings; Patricia Chandler a nationally recognized distinguished fine and commercial artist, art instructor, illustrator, and retired art educator well known for her knowledge and ability to create original art across all genres; Carrin Culotta recognized for her traditional style plein air and in studio oil paintings; Kevin Daley known for his plein air and in studio oil paintings; Tim Eaton a distinguished nationally recognized commercial and fine artist known for his stunning in studio oil paintings; Kenneth Mancini known for his paintings in oil; and HM Saffer II an internationally renowned, award-winning performing and visual artist famed for his magnificently layered pointillist style landscape paintings.
